The Sims 4 Blast From the Past Event - stuck with a quest

Hello,

I rarely have problems with in-game events in The Sims 4, but today when I started playing the Event, Week 2, I got stuck with a simple quest (Echoes of Time) when you go to a Museum and your sim has to "Study a Historical Display". The problem is, the only option I get is to "View" a scuplture, a painting and even though I did it so many times with different families and households on various Museum lots, nothing happened and I can"t move forward.

  • So, here's what worked for me:

    1) I repaired the game, 

    2) my sims kept viewing different objects (requires a lot of patience) as Luministly and DatBoiOnline suggested.

    And after several sim hours it fianally worked!!  :-)

    I had this issue too, but it ended up fixing itself. I clicked 'View' on a ton of sculptures and then reloaded the lot when I saw it had progressed onto the next step. I hope that if it hasn't already been fixed for you that it fixes soon! It makes you wonder when they playtest The Sims 4...

  • think I have the solution. it worked for me at least. just let the sim view the object (they really like to view the object for a long time) and once they're done, it should complete that. dunno why they didn't change the option, but that's the sims 4. :/
